Who We Are
The Oakland Kendo Dojo was established in 1953 by founding members, Hiroshi Umemoto, Gordon Warner,
Benjamin Hazard, Yoshinari Miyata, Shoichi Fujishima and Seiichi Umemoto.
Over the past 73 years, we have hosted numerous guests, including top Kendo instructors and competitors from across the United States, Japan, and Europe and have taught countless men, women, and children of all ages. Currently, our 60-plus members are guided by Chief Instructor and Senior Advisor of the Northern California Kendo Federation, Tanouye Sensei, Renshi Roku-dan
(6 Dan).
Oakland Kendo Dojo Inc. is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it and a member of the Northern California Kendo Federation (NCKF) and the All United States Kendo Federation (AUSKF).
